Telstra Store Macarthur Square

Comments on Telstra Store Macarthur Square. Shop 47-48 Macarthur Square, 200 Gilchrist Dr, Campbelltown 2560 NSW
Please share as much information as you can about Telstra Store Macarthur Square so other users can benefit from your comment.
Can't read?